What companies run services between Fargo, ND, USA and Nova Scotia, Canada?

United Airlines, American Airlines, and two other airlines fly from Hector International Airport (FAR) to Halifax Stanfield International Airport (YHZ) twice daily. Alternatively, you can take a train from Fargo Amtrak Station to Halifax via Chicago Union Station, Detroit, Windsor, Toronto Union Station, and Montréal in around 2d 7h.
